From 66c9a8ddcf98dcea1e2d1e46084ebb6dc91f87a3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Tomasz=20Kapu=C5=9Bci=C5=84ski?= Date: Sun, 15 Sep 2024 21:17:12 +0200 Subject: [PATCH] Replaced downloading using wget with CMake's FILE(DOWNLOAD) --- music/CMakeLists.txt | 14 ++++---------- 1 file changed, 4 insertions(+), 10 deletions(-) diff --git a/music/CMakeLists.txt b/music/CMakeLists.txt index 6650a1958..65f6f9da5 100644 --- a/music/CMakeLists.txt +++ b/music/CMakeLists.txt @@ -57,8 +57,6 @@ if(MUSIC) ) endif() - find_program(WGET wget) - foreach(FILE ${MUSIC_FILES}) get_filename_component(FILENAME ${FILE} NAME_WE) @@ -73,14 +71,10 @@ if(MUSIC) message(STATUS "Music file ${DOWNLOAD_FILE} already downloaded") set(DOWNLOAD_FILE_LOC "${CMAKE_CURRENT_SOURCE_DIR}/${DOWNLOAD_FILE}") else() - if(NOT WGET) - message(FATAL_ERROR "wget not found, music files can't be downloaded!") - endif() - - execute_process( - COMMAND ${CMAKE_COMMAND} -E echo "Downloading ${DOWNLOAD_FILE}..." - COMMAND ${WGET} -N "https://colobot.info/files/music/${DOWNLOAD_FILE}" - WORKING_D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R} + message(STATUS "Downloading ${DOWNLOAD_FILE}...") + file(DOWNLOAD + "https://colobot.info/files/music/${DOWNLOAD_FILE}" + "${CMAKE_CURRENT_SOURCE_DIR}/${DOWNLOAD_FILE}" ) set(DOWNLOAD_FILE_LOC "${CMAKE_CURRENT_SOURCE_DIR}/${DOWNLOAD_FILE}")